Output d66f2dde160d87282fce7fe145cdbd6a42ffa16cf2ff17bd06226c19a58939e5:1

value
17034862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fcab7598c952f09929de5c56034bade7ec19d29 OP_EQUALVERIFY OP_CHECKSIG
address
1MQJXkME6EjrEJ16jmoPXhkuK6suEXRcvE
transaction
d66f2dde160d87282fce7fe145cdbd6a42ffa16cf2ff17bd06226c19a58939e5
confirmations
477661
spent
true